Hardcore parody is the sound of a generation exorcising its fears through laughter. It takes the demonic, the sacred ground of horror, and drags it into the messy, loud, profane human realm. Here, demons are not ancient evils; they are annoying roommates. Ouija boards are just bad Uber Eats. And the scariest thing in the house isn’t the entity in the attic—it’s the realization that you’ve seen this movie three times and you still jump at the kitchen light flickering.
